Speechify is looking for a Senior Software Engineer to lead the design, architecture, and development of native Windows desktop applications using Windows App SDK, WinUI, and C#. The ideal candidate should have 3+ years of experience in Windows desktop application development and a deep understanding of Windows application architecture. Responsibilities include leading technical design, mentoring other engineers, and making architecture-level decisions. Speechify is a 100% distributed company with a flat-structure engineering culture and a purpose-driven mission to build software that's reliable, accessible, and user-centered.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ience in Windows desktop application development using Windows App SDK, WinUI, and C#
  • Deep understanding of Windows application architecture, including interop between managed code (.NET) and native code
  • Proven track record of designing, building, and shipping production-quality desktop applications
  • Strong experience with accessibility APIs on Windows (e.g. Microsoft UI Automation or similar)
  • Excellent software engineering fundamentals: OOP, design patterns, data structures, algorithms, memory management, multi-threading or asynchronous programming (where relevant)
  • Experience leading technical design, mentoring other engineers, conducting code reviews, and making architecture-level decisions
  • Strong communication skills and ability to articulate tradeoffs, collaborate with cross-functional teams, and drive consensus
  • A user-centric mindset: focus on building polished, intuitive, and accessible experiences for end users
